(Salt Lake City, UT) — Utah is joining another lawsuit against COVID-19 vaccination mandates imposed by the Biden Administration. The lawsuit filed yesterday seeks to overturn a mandate requiring coronavirus vaccinations for workers at healthcare facilities that accept Medicaid and Medicare funding. Utah and 11 other states are challenging the mandate, saying the federal government is trying to take away a constitutional power that should belong solely to each state. The court filing also claims the Biden Administration is ignoring the ongoing healthcare labor shortage by forcing employees to choose between getting vaccinated or losing their jobs.
